Transaction d6fc1ae7899817d63a69bf25bd70e4e45ebe9fb5ecca44b24459bc422413492d

25 Input
2 Outputs
  • d6fc1ae7899817d63a69bf25bd70e4e45ebe9fb5ecca44b24459bc422413492d:0
  • value  83869
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• d6fc1ae7899817d63a69bf25bd70e4e45ebe9fb5ecca44b24459bc422413492d:1
  • value  7479695
    address  3JcG3hFoYNbxzkvVETnaMjFDVEUNEFzDFG